Job description
We are Para la Naturaleza, a non-profit organization focused on the conservation of the islands of Puerto Rico. We are looking for an individual to join our team as Senior Project Manager. This is a hybrid position, based in our headquarters at Old San Juan. Sr. Project Manager will provide direction on what project management methodologies are used when managing the project, whether traditional waterfall or an agile framework. This professional will support the development and deployment of Para La Naturaleza (PLN) Project Management Training Program.
Sr. Project Manager will assist project teams to organize projects with the goal of getting them completed on time and within budget. In addition, he/she may support the oversee PLN projects portfolio to ensure that active projects are managed following the defined processes and standards; monitors and reports portfolio status to assure it is achieving the goals and objectives of the organization. He/she may be tasked with managing one or more portfolios and/or strategic projects, as applicable; will evaluate the project management process, and recommends improvements.
This is a contracted position (professional services) to be hired for a period of 12 months.
